WhatsApp Developers: Connecting the World Through Voice
目录导读:
在当今数字化时代,即时通讯工具已经成为人们日常交流的重要组成部分,WhatsApp无疑是最受欢迎的全球性聊天应用程序之一,对于许多开发者来说,如何利用WhatsApp提供的API(应用程序接口)进行创新应用的设计是一个挑战,本文将深入探讨WhatsApp的开发者社区,并详细介绍其平台的功能、开发流程以及一些成功的应用案例。
WhatsApp开发者平台概览
WhatsApp提供了一个全面的开发者平台,允许开发者创建各种功能丰富的应用程序来连接世界各地的用户,通过该平台,开发者可以使用WhatsApp的端对端加密技术、联系人管理、消息传递等功能为用户提供独特体验。
功能特性
- 消息传递: 拥有强大的消息发送和接收功能。
- 联系人管理: 管理群组和个人联系人的能力。
- 位置共享: 实现地理位置跟踪功能。
- 语音和视频通话: 支持高质量的音频和视频通话。
- 支付功能: 允许用户进行在线支付交易。
开发过程详解
设计和规划
开发WhatsApp的应用首先需要明确目标市场和功能需求,开发者应仔细研究WhatsApp的文档和技术规格,以确保应用符合平台标准并能够充分利用WhatsApp的丰富功能。
编码与测试
编码阶段通常包括前端和后端两个部分,前端负责实现用户界面,而后端则处理数据传输和业务逻辑,在编码过程中,务必遵循WhatsApp的安全协议,确保应用的数据安全和隐私保护。
部署上线
完成所有开发工作后,开发者需提交应用到WhatsApp的审核系统,经过严格审查后,如果一切顺利,应用将在WhatsApp平台上发布,供全球用户下载和使用。
案例分析
成功应用实例
- GroupMe: GroupMe是一款基于WhatsApp的跨平台社交媒体应用,它提供了更加直观的消息管理和群组服务,吸引了大量用户。
- Tango: Tango是一个基于AR(增强现实)技术的社交网络应用,结合了WhatsApp的语音和视频通话功能,为用户提供全新的社交体验。
遇到的问题及解决方案
尽管WhatsApp提供了丰富的功能和资源,但在实际开发过程中仍可能遇到各种问题,如何优化性能、如何处理大规模并发请求等,解决这些问题的关键在于持续学习WhatsApp的技术更新,同时寻求专业帮助或参与开发者社区的讨论。
WhatsApp的开发者社区为开发者提供了无限的可能性,无论是想要创建新的社交媒体应用,还是想利用WhatsApp的独特优势改进现有产品,都可以在这个平台上找到灵感和指导,随着新技术的发展,WhatsApp将继续引领即时通讯领域的变革,希望本文能激发更多开发者探索WhatsApp的世界,创造出更多的创新应用。
通过上述内容,我们不仅了解了WhatsApp的开发者平台及其关键功能,还看到了成功应用的例子以及面对挑战时的应对策略,无论你是初学者还是资深开发者,WhatsApp都是一个值得投资的领域,希望这篇文章能为你开启通往WhatsApp世界的窗口,让你更好地利用这一强大的工具。